Transaction cc8e56008839c629973cb40b73494230a21b87330a4f39275410a1baa0946636
1 Input
1 Output
-
cc8e56008839c629973cb40b73494230a21b87330a4f39275410a1baa0946636:0
- value
- 39895
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a729aba3029ea3ed08d09264a801d689e5ae6f86 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GEsmMHV1dDwud75dLRmLLhvvAyFetfJkF